About the Job

We're a long established, world leading company with even bigger ambitions. So, we have much more potential to achieve and products to innovate - responsibly and sustainably.



You'll enjoy a challenging, rewarding role that offers the opportunity to make a real impact on a sustainable, successful future - for us, our clients and the planet. Co-operating, locally and internationally, with our designers & specialists from various functions, you'll play your part in leading new product development by adapting both calculation methods and calculation tools. As far as development and existing product improvement is concerned, you will support our designers with calculations and simulations to ensure at an early stage that our heat exchangers achieve the expected performance.



As a team member within R&D, you will be able to contribute with your creativity and knowledge in the construction of sustainable development.



In certain parts of the role, you may work with interpretations of various pressure vessel and construction regulations. This means working actively with various authorities to ensure that changes are beneficial for our products. It's an all-encompassing role that will also see you work with R&D reviewing and ensuring that the construction meets the dimensioning requirements placed on the product itself based on specific regulations. It includes deep diving in requirements, regulations and/or technical documentations.



In other parts of the role, you may work with calculation and numerical simulations in concept development or root cause analysis cases. The normal questions in this part relates to evaluation of solid mechanics such as vibration, fatigue, forming, steel & packaging materials, welding joints and similar.



If you are interested in these different aspects of calculations and numerical simulations and the interpretations of various pressure vessel and construction regulations - this may just be the role for you.



We are all about hiring for potential, so depending on our needs, your interests and your competence, you may focus on different parts of the above-mentioned areas of responsibility within pressure vessel standards and/or calculation.

About the job

We offer an interesting job opportunity within the Business Unit Electrolyzer and Fuel cell Technology (BU-EFT) for you who enjoy working with key customers in a global market. Key is for you to have knowledge of manufacturing/production processes.



You will be based in Lund and report to Head of Development for Electrolyzer and Fuel cell technologies.



As Development Engineer, you will work with the process development for our Bi-Polar Plate (BPP) designs and other thermal components for the electrolyzer and fuel cell systems in an international context.



You will work mainly with technologies in project form in very close cooperation with other Development engineers, Application specialists and Laboratory technicians. In addition, you will interact with other Development Engineers as well as key customers.



Your main responsibilities includes development, design and optimization of equipment and fixtures for the Bi-Polar Plate (BPP) and other electrolyzer/fuel cell components. Also included simulation and optimization of brazing processes. Design is done in our 3D-CAD system, and product data is managed in our PDM system.

The European Spallation Source is one of the largest science and technology infrastructure projects being built today. The project includes the most powerful linear proton accelerator ever built, a five-tonne, helium-cooled tungsten target wheel, 15 state-of-the-art neutron instruments, a suite of laboratories, and a supercomputing data management and software development centre.
